Date: Tuesday, June 6, 2017 @ 10:41:09 Author: felixonmars Revision: 234909
upgpkg: python-coverage 4.4.1-1 Modified: python-coverage/trunk/PKGBUILD ----------+ PKGBUILD | 23 +++++++++++++---------- 1 file changed, 13 insertions(+), 10 deletions(-) Modified: PKGBUILD =================================================================== --- PKGBUILD 2017-06-06 10:38:16 UTC (rev 234908) +++ PKGBUILD 2017-06-06 10:41:09 UTC (rev 234909) @@ -3,23 +3,26 @@ # Contributor: Clément Démoulins <[email protected]> # Contributor: Fazlul Shahriar <[email protected]> +pkgbase=python-coverage pkgname=(python-coverage python2-coverage) -pkgver=4.3.4 +pkgver=4.4.1 pkgrel=1 pkgdesc="A tool for measuring code coverage of Python programs" arch=('i686' 'x86_64') url="http://nedbatchelder.com/code/coverage/" license=('Apache') -makedepends=('python-setuptools' 'python2-setuptools' 'mercurial') +makedepends=('python-setuptools' 'python2-setuptools') checkdepends=('python-mock' 'python2-mock' 'python-pytest-xdist' 'python2-pytest-xdist' 'python-pycontracts' 'python2-pycontracts' 'python-greenlet' 'python2-greenlet' 'python-virtualenv' 'python2-virtualenv' 'python-pyenchant' 'python2-pyenchant' - 'python-pylint' 'python2-pylint' 'python-unittest-mixins' 'python2-unittest-mixins') -source=("hg+https://bitbucket.org/ned/coveragepy#tag=coverage-$pkgver") -md5sums=('SKIP') + 'python-pylint' 'python2-pylint' 'python-unittest-mixins' 'python2-unittest-mixins' + 'python-flaky' 'python2-flaky') +source=("$pkgbase-$pkgver.tar.gz::https://bitbucket.org/ned/coveragepy/get/coverage-$pkgver.tar.gz") +sha512sums=('c2729123f4aa8af0b1cb1f123fc5359075c66a7a6a26c32d883adbc24c81a39cd81b281db3a92019f4189f098eb12ab0f07b25dd3a120f4b0f5d5e899d8a78ee') prepare() { - cp -a coveragepy{,-py2} + mv ned-coveragepy-* coveragepy-$pkgver + cp -a coveragepy-$pkgver{,-py2} } check() { @@ -28,7 +31,7 @@ export LC_CTYPE=en_US.UTF-8 ( - cd "$srcdir/coveragepy" + cd "$srcdir/coveragepy-$pkgver" virtualenv "$srcdir/pyvenv" --system-site-packages . "$srcdir/pyvenv/bin/activate" export PYTHONPATH="$PYTHONPATH:/usr/lib/python3.6/site-packages" @@ -40,7 +43,7 @@ ) ( - cd "$srcdir/coveragepy-py2" + cd "$srcdir/coveragepy-$pkgver-py2" virtualenv2 "$srcdir/pyvenv-py2" --system-site-packages . "$srcdir/pyvenv-py2/bin/activate" export PYTHONPATH="$PYTHONPATH:/usr/lib/python2.7/site-packages" @@ -55,7 +58,7 @@ package_python-coverage() { depends=('python') - cd coveragepy + cd coveragepy-$pkgver python3 setup.py install --root="$pkgdir" --optimize=1 } @@ -62,7 +65,7 @@ package_python2-coverage() { depends=('python2') - cd coveragepy + cd coveragepy-$pkgver python2 setup.py install --root="$pkgdir" --optimize=1 mv "$pkgdir/usr/bin/coverage" "$pkgdir/usr/bin/coverage2"
